From a4e7bf3a89a986f0055bb8b6c6890449ca405f39 Mon Sep 17 00:00:00 2001 From: Jelmer Vernooij Date: Fri, 28 Oct 2005 21:13:30 +0000 Subject: r11382: Require number of required M4 macros Make MODULE handling a bit more like BINARY, LIBRARY and SUBSYSTEM Add some more PUBLIC_HEADERS (This used to be commit 875eb8f4cc658e6aebab070029fd499a726ad520) --- source4/auth/gensec/config.m4 | 10 ++-------- source4/auth/gensec/config.mk | 1 + 2 files changed, 3 insertions(+), 8 deletions(-) (limited to 'source4/auth/gensec') diff --git a/source4/auth/gensec/config.m4 b/source4/auth/gensec/config.m4 index af17e896a4..b945afeea0 100644 --- a/source4/auth/gensec/config.m4 +++ b/source4/auth/gensec/config.m4 @@ -1,8 +1,2 @@ -SMB_MODULE_DEFAULT(gensec_krb5, NOT) -SMB_MODULE_DEFAULT(gensec_gssapi, NOT) - -if test x"$HAVE_KRB5" = x"YES"; then - # krb5 is now disabled at runtime, not build time - SMB_MODULE_DEFAULT(gensec_krb5, STATIC) - SMB_MODULE_DEFAULT(gensec_gssapi, STATIC) -fi +SMB_ENABLE(gensec_krb5, $HAVE_KRB5) +SMB_ENABLE(gensec_gssapi, $HAVE_KRB5) diff --git a/source4/auth/gensec/config.mk b/source4/auth/gensec/config.mk index d1a89038ad..57f7bc4f0d 100644 --- a/source4/auth/gensec/config.mk +++ b/source4/auth/gensec/config.mk @@ -4,6 +4,7 @@ MAJOR_VERSION = 0 MINOR_VERSION = 0 RELEASE_VERSION = 1 +PUBLIC_HEADERS = gensec.h INIT_FUNCTION = gensec_init INIT_OBJ_FILES = gensec.o REQUIRED_SUBSYSTEMS = \ -- cgit